About YYLO LEDGER
YYLO is a system of work for agentic engineering that coordinates coding agents from intent through validated, reviewable code while preserving durable task, session, review, and evaluation evidence. It manages task truth and dependencies in Git, delegates bounded work across agents and models, runs executions in isolated worktrees with session provenance, and produces durable receipts for validation, review, and merging. Retained benchmark evidence enables comparison of agent attempts and evaluation over time.
Key Features
- Manage task truth and dependencies directly in Git
- Delegate bounded tasks across agents and models
- Execute work in isolated Git worktrees with session provenance
- Validate, review and merge code with durable receipts
- Compare agent attempts using retained benchmark evidence
Who is this for?
Engineering teams, AI/ML engineers, developer tool builders and teams using agentic LLM workflows
